DescriptionDescription: This is the only work in the National Portrait Gallery that is painted in a drawer. Marianne Lindberg De Geer’s portrait is expressive, with bold colours. It highlights characteristics of the sitter such as his glasses, red scarf and eloquent gestures. Carlo Derkert is shown at work, guiding a museum tour. On the wall there are paintings, and behind him two of his listeners. Derkert was an important innovator in museum education, working chiefly at the Nationalmuseum and Moderna Museet.
